Output e381764638552089875c316687860e3150e30d6fad0fe8074e25066f13951a66:1

value
1901483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 572e483f509ee4f2a0d44fb32585869fcf0bab9b OP_EQUAL
address
39dz9yfQgYoFXoU6U145iWyq9zpppPfhq5
transaction
e381764638552089875c316687860e3150e30d6fad0fe8074e25066f13951a66
spent
true